Just for information - there are a number of questions on this topic where the problem is that (in a supported region) it is impossible to complete setup of the irregular heart notification setup because the Next button is greyed out. There is a section which should be above this screen which requires you to verify your age, and in this scenario it doesn't show up so you can't continue. Other people have suggested that by scrolling hard up and down and/or scrolling in different parts of the screen - you could make the option appear. This never worked for me.
However I just noticed what my problem was. I use reading glasses for small print, and as I don't like wearing them to look at my phone, I had turned the text size up in the general settings for my iPhone. Setting them back to the default made the age verification section and enabled me to complete setup.

I had a problem where irregular heartbeat function was not reporting. After restoring the app, restoring the Charge 5, restoring the iPhone. It still didn't update the IH info. So I turned off the feature only to run into the problem of the greyed out 'next' field when I attempted to turn it on again. Yes, changing the iPhone default font size to small fixed the problem and I was able to turn on IH reporting. Never would I ever have come up with the idea that the font size was a problem.
